I am working on setting up a Debian 3.1 box that uses FreeTDS to connect to a Microsoft SQL 7.0 server. http://www.freetds.org/userguide/choosingtdsprotocol.htm recommends using TDS version 7.0. This sounds good except for the fact that, when using TDS 7.0, it appears that quoted identifiers default to on (more details: https://lists.ibiblio.org/sympa/arc/freetds/2003q2/013103.html). We need to have quoted identifiers set to off.

Is there any way to use FreeTDS/TDS 7.0 and set quoted identifiers to off either in freetds.conf or in some kind of start up SQL script run by FreeTDS? If not, we'll need to use TDS 4.2 and keep in mind the limitations it imposes (http://www.freetds.org/userguide/choosingtdsprotocol.htm).
